Elusive British music collective SAULT have released a new album entitled Air. The group shared artwork and teaser images through social media channels yesterday shortly before unveiling the project’s seven tracks on a name your price basis.

Air marks the critically acclaimed group’s sixth album succeeding last year’s Nine which was available to download and purchase on physical formats for ninety-nine days before being wiped from the internet.

In the time between the two releases SAULT’s central component Dean Josiah Cover – known in musical circles as Inflo – was awarded the title of Producer Of The Year at the 2022 edition of the Brit Awards, whilst singer-songwriter Cleo Sol released her sophomore album Mother to broad praise and frequent collaborators Steve Pringle and Graham Godfrey launched the debut EP from their disco and no wave-infused group Pigeon.

Another stylistic left turn for the group that begins in a flurry of strings and clarion call horns before venturing in to realms of swooning orchestral and new age music, hear Air in full below.
